top of page
fond.png

What is Better USD

simplifies your USD workflows across DCCs

betterUSD.png

Better USD is a software designed to unify USD workflows across all DCC applications into a single, consistent pipeline. It allows artists and technical directors to build and manage their entire USD workflow procedurally, without needing to write code.

With Better USD, you can automate USD exports, version your layers, generate asset variants, and structure your USD stacks exactly the way you want. Whether used through its intuitive UI or in standalone mode, it gives you full control over how your USD data is created, organized, and maintained.

Built entirely on USD and its API, Better USD ensures seamless interoperability between different software like Maya, Houdini, Blender, and more. It acts as a complete USD pipeline solution, enabling teams to standardize workflows, reduce inconsistencies between DCCs, and significantly streamline production processes.

Better USD is currently available only on Windows, and the tool is still in its alpha version.

This software will make your life easier by saving a considerable amount of time in your 3D creations. It simplifies your USD workflows across DCCs and supports you throughout your entire production process, from modeling to rendering. It is a useful and user-friendly tool.

You can watch the demonstration video to see the software in action.

betterUSD is avalable on:​

Houdini.png

HOUDINI

Houdini 20.5  /  Houdini 21.0

better USD does not currently take into account the usdnc files of houdini​​

Maya.png

MAYA 

Maya 2024 / Maya 2025 /

Maya 2026

Blender.png

BLENDER

Blender version 4.2 or later

Better USD Documentation

Better USD Documentation

Download the last version of Better USD

last version : Alpha 0.2.0

node-based.png

NODE-BASED

The system is built entirely around a node-based architecture, providing unmatched flexibility and allowing users to customize every aspect of their workflow. Thanks to the extensive range of available nodes, virtually any creative or technical requirement can be achieved with ease. By combining nodes, users can design tailored pipelines that adapt perfectly to their production needs, maximizing efficiency, scalability, and creative control.

DCC_integration.png

DCC INTEGRATION

Thanks to BetterUSD's native integrations across multiple DCC applications, you can build seamless cross-DCC workflows without worrying about compatibility issues or differences in USD composition and management methodologies. Create USD variants, Layered Interactive Variant Editing Pipelines (LIVERPs), and complex asset structures across different software environments while maintaining a consistent and predictable workflow. Whether an asset is created in Maya, Blender, or any other supported DCC, the resulting USD output remains standardized and production-ready.

USD_native.png

USD NATIVE

BetterUSD is built natively on top of USD, ensuring complete integration with the entire USD ecosystem. From core rendering technologies to advanced pipeline features, every component is designed to fully leverage USD's capabilities, including composition arcs, LIVERPs, Asset Resolvers, custom USD plugins, and much more. This deep integration makes BetterUSD a true USD-native solution rather than an external layer built around USD. As a result, users benefit from maximum compatibility, exceptional performance, and seamless interoperability across all supported DCC applications.

arc_comp.png

ARC COMPOSITIONS

All USD composition workflows are exposed through a flexible set of nodes that can be used at any stage of the pipeline. This gives users complete control over how assets, layers, variants, and compositions are assembled and managed throughout production.

Every node can be combined and customized to match specific project requirements, allowing you to build workflows that are as simple or as sophisticated as needed. Whether you need a standardized pipeline or a highly specialized structure for a unique production challenge, BetterUSD adapts to your workflow.

context_options.png

CONTEXT OPTIONS 

With the Contexts Options, you can automate the management and deployment of .btu files across all supported DCC applications. Contexts provide a centralized way to control parameters, configurations, and workflow behaviors, ensuring consistency throughout your production pipeline. Beyond simple configuration management, the context Options allows you to create reusable presets and custom node groups that encapsulate entire workflow sections. These building blocks can be shared, reused, and deployed across projects, significantly reducing setup time and eliminating repetitive tasks.

python.png

PYTHON API

A powerful and intuitive Python API provides seamless access to every feature available in BetterUSD. Designed to abstract the complexity of the extensive USD APIs, it allows developers, technical artists, and pipeline engineers to interact with USD workflows through a simplified and production-focused interface. Everything that can be achieved through the graphical interface can also be accomplished programmatically via the Python API.

standalone.png

STANDALONE SYSTEM

BetterUSD includes a powerful Standalone Mode, allowing you to access and execute the entire ecosystem without launching the graphical user interface. Through Python and the btu API, you can create, modify, connect, and execute nodes programmatically to build complete USD workflows entirely from code. The standalone environment provides full access to BetterUSD's workflow engine, enabling rapid automation, batch processing, and seamless integration into existing production pipelines. Whether you need to generate USD structures, configure complex node networks.

Report bug & Questions & Suggestions.

Thank you for your submission!

bottom of page